| Summary: The dsindex max_clean option does not set the server to Admin mode, and no action is required from you regarding Admin mode when running this command. This article documents a past documentation error and its correction; it does not describe a product defect. |
Issue
An earlier version of the DocuShare Command Line Utilities Guide described the dsindex max_clean option as follows:
| max_clean - Comprehensive. Removes old files, compresses the database, defragments the disk, and performs optimize. Sets server to admin mode. |
The final sentence, "Sets server to admin mode," was incorrect. The max_clean option does not set the server to Admin mode. This was a documentation error, not a product defect.
Current Status
This documentation error has been corrected. Current versions of the DocuShare Command Line Utilities Guide describe max_clean without the incorrect Admin mode statement:
| max_clean - Comprehensive. Removes old files, compresses the database, defragments the disk, and performs optimize. |
If you are referencing an older copy of the Command Line Utilities Guide that still contains the incorrect statement, disregard that sentence and obtain the current guide for your DocuShare release.
What This Means for You
- You do not need to set Admin mode before running dsindex max_clean, and you do not need to take any action to clear Admin mode afterward. The command does not change the system mode.
- This is different from dsindex index_all, which does set the server to Admin mode automatically while the operation runs, and restores normal operation when it completes. Do not assume the two commands behave the same way with respect to Admin mode.
- If you want to restrict site access while running max_clean for your own operational reasons, you may set Admin mode manually beforehand using standard site administration steps. This is a choice you can make based on your environment; it is not required by max_clean itself.
Support Guidance
If you observe different behavior than described here, or if dsindex max_clean appears to change the system mode in your environment, contact Xerox DocuShare Support and provide your DocuShare version and patch level, the exact command used, and the site's System Mode value before and after running the command.
